The street in brief

Nottingham Way is a mix of terraced houses and detached houses. Homes here typically change hands around £141,000 — roughly 19% below the DY5 norm. On floor area that works out near £2,590 per square metre, above the district's £2,326. Too few recent sales to read a street-level trend, but across DY5 prices have been rising over the last few years. The record shows 35 sales across 18 homes since 2000.

Nottingham Way's £141,000 median sits about 19% below DY5's £175,000; on floor space it runs £2,590/m² against the district's £2,326/m² (+11%).

Street and DY5 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.
